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9065892631 83756 3044 2221 73
6029 9920100157 30254916
6029 9920100157 30254916
327374 1012363672 91
All about undefined
Interested in learning more?
6029 9920100157 30254916
327374 1012363672 91
See more
364306803 40083
746076 593386334 06
See more
57000060093 4359
86053 8215685384 867 33 98876376
See more